Front-line essential workers and adults 75 and over should be next to get the coronavirus vaccine, a CDC advisory group says

The recommendations, which come two days after regulators authorized a second coronavirus vaccine, will guide state authorities in deciding who should have priority to receive limited doses of vaccines made by Pfizer-BioNTech and Moderna.
